Had to replace a copious amount of these. Luckily this one failed while cleaning a route. It was at the first bolt. All the ClimbX hangers were replaced after only being installed a year prior. Most of the hangers, 90 in all, had a crack in the same area as the example in the picture. Scary thing is, these are still being sold.
Having most of 90 bolts fail in one year is astounding and "Scary" is an understatement. A modern double bolt anchor, something you don't even consider, could actually fail. I've heard ClimbX hangers were junk from China, but this is truly stunning.
